How Jon Scheyer rose from Duke ‘particular assistant’ to Mike Krzyzewski’s successor in eight years

[ad_1]

Simply 11 years faraway from main Duke to the 2010 NCA A Event championship as a participant, Jon Scheyer will quickly be put in place to steer the Blue Devils to nationwide prominence once more. This time, it will not be because the crew’s captain however as an alternative as this system’s twentieth coach.

The college introduced Wednesday that Scheyer has been tabbed to will substitute Mike Krzyzewski as soon as Coach Okay retires following the 2021-22 season.

At simply 33, Scheyer is a decade youthful than the ACC’s present youngest head coach, Georgia Tech’s Josh Pastner, and he’ll turn out to be one of many youngest Division I coaches within the nation. Nevertheless, a take a look at again on the final 15 years of Scheyer’s taking part in and training profession illustrate why Krzyzewski is likely to be comfy handing the reins of an illustrious program to somebody so younger.

Scheyer is not simply Krzyzewski’s present affiliate head coach; he’s a storied former participant for the legendary coach and a blossoming recruiter who, in idea, may seamlessly transition to the pinnacle position and lead this system in a time of transition for faculty basketball.

The participant

Ranked as a four-star prospect within the Class of 2006 by the 247Sports Composite, Scheyer signed with Duke out of Glenbrook North Excessive College close to Chicago and rapidly took on a key position by beginning and averaging 12.2 factors per recreation as a freshman. He finally appeared in 144 video games throughout his school profession, which culminated with Duke’s nationwide title run in 2010.

Scheyer was the main scorer as a senior for that crew, which completed 35-5 and secured Krzyzewski’s fourth title with a 61-59 win over Butler within the nationwide championship recreation. He completed his profession with 2,077 profession factors, which ranks tenth on this system’s all-time scoring listing.

As a 6-foot-5 guard, Scheyer was identified for his 3-point capturing and nonetheless ranks fourth all-time in program historical past for each 3-point makes an attempt and makes, bBut he additionally flashed his distributing expertise as a senior by handing out 4.9 assists per recreation.

The trail again to Duke

After going undrafted in 2010, Scheyer suffered a severe damage to his proper eye whereas taking part in with the Miami Warmth in an NBA Summer season League recreation. The incident left him legally blind however didn’t derail his taking part in ambitions. Scheyer performed within the G League and abroad from 2011-13 till becoming a member of the Duke employees as a particular assistant for the 2013-14 season. He assisted in growing recreation plans, breaking down movie and in planning practices, in accordance with program archives.

“I’m extraordinarily lucky to have the ability to come again to Duke,” Scheyer mentioned on the time. “It’s a super honor to be on Coach Okay’s employees and it’s one thing I’ll cherish. I need to proceed to be taught from the complete employees and convey no matter I can to assist this system.”

The teaching rise

When Duke affiliate head coach Steve Wojciechowski left to turn out to be Marquette’s coach after the 2013-14 season, Krzyzewski promoted Jeff Capel to the position and Scheyer to fill Capel’s vacated assistant spot. 

“We’re ecstatic about Jon becoming a member of the employees,” Krzyzewski mentioned on the time. “He was one of many nice gamers to play at Duke: a nationwide champion and a captain not that far eliminated so he provides a youthful exuberance to our employees. His information of the sport is unbelievable. I believe he will likely be a terrific train and an impressive recruiter.” 

When Capel left to take the pinnacle teaching job at Pittsburgh after the 2017-18 season, Scheyer and Nate James had been promoted to affiliate head coaches, persevering with Krzyzewski’s choice of counting on his former gamers in key employees roles. 

“Nate and Jon are former captains who clearly perceive Duke and our tradition,” Krzyzewski mentioned on the time. “They’re each nationwide champions who’ve performed an integral position in our success over the previous twenty years. Nearly as good as they had been as gamers, they usually had been each glorious, they’ve been outstanding, distinguished and instinctive coaches who’ve earned this chance. With Nate and Jon assuming further tasks of their affiliate head coach roles, I’m excited concerning the make-up of our employees shifting ahead.”

James was named the coach at Austin Peay in April, clearing the runway for Scheyer because the pure successor to Krzyzewski if this system opted to rent from inside upon Krzyzewski’s retirement.

If not at Duke, it was clear that Scheyer was destined to turn out to be a head coach elsewhere sooner or later, if he wished. Although simply now approaching his mid-30s, Scheyer was rumored to be amongst Pittsburgh’s candidates in 2018 when Capel finally acquired the job. His title additionally got here up within the rumor mill throughout this yr’s teaching carousel in reference to the DePaul job.

Contemplating Scheyer’s rising fame as a prime recruiter, it is no shock that he is drawn curiosity from different packages. Among the many prospects he is helped deliver to Duke as a major recruiter are Jayson Tatum, Cam Reddish, Vernon Carey and 2021 five-star ahead Paolo Banchero, in accordance with 247Sports. He was additionally the secondary recruiter for Zion Williamson.

Scheyer can be credited with serving to develop current Duke stars resembling Tyus Jones, Luke Kennard, Frank Jackson and Grayson Allen into NBA Draft picks.
